Please wait a bit while StatShow is computing website's data...

Google search volume for "swelldweller"

Website results for "swelldweller"

 1 website found

#195,427 (+195%) - swelldweller-sheffield.co.uk
Title: Swell Dweller - Sheffield property advertising website incorporating comprehensive business and city guides
Description: property advertising website incorporating comprehensive business and city guides